Casino PayPal Deposit 2026: Is It Safe for UK Players?

Yes. Absolutely. But let me be honest about one thing. PayPal is not a bank. They have their own rules. If you’re a heavy gambler, PayPal might flag your account. I’ve heard stories of people having their PayPal limited because they were depositing and withdrawing too frequently. It’s rare, but it happens.

From what I’ve seen, as long as you’re not doing 10 deposits a day, you’re fine. I do maybe 2-3 deposits a week. Never had an issue. And the security is top-notch. Your card details never go to the casino. It’s all handled by PayPal. That’s a big plus for me.
